Shehu Sani condemns killing of 16-years-old boy by security operatives in Kaduna

Former Kaduna Central senator, Shehu Sani has condemned the killing of an innocent boy by security operatives in Kaduna State.

DAILY POST recalls that security operatives who were in Barnawa community searching for illicit drug dealers opened fire on the 16 years old boy, identified as Abubakar, killing him instantly.

Youths in the community had protested the killing, calling on the state government to arrest the security agent and make him face the full consequences of his actions

Sani condemned the killing when he paid a condolence visit to the father of the deceased, Abubakar, in Barnawa, Kaduna South Local Government Area.

He described the killing as an indefensible and barbaric act that violates every principle of human rights and the sanctity of life.

The former lawmaker called on the state government, Nigerian Police Force and National Human Rights Commission to urgently investigate the matter and prosecute the killer.

He said “This was somebody’s child, not a statistic. Justice for Abubakar is justice for every Nigerian who believes in the rule of law.”

Earlier the grieving father of the deceased, Abubakar, who recounted the ordeal said the operatives stormed the community, prompting residents to scatter in fear.

According to him, he advised his son not to run, believing there was nothing to fear. Moments later, an operative allegedly grabbed Abubakar from behind, drew a pistol, pressed it to his head, and fired, killing him instantly.

“This was not an accident; it was an execution,” the father said, calling for those responsible to face the full weight of the law.
